Bandolwa - Benipatti, Madhubani
Bandolwa is a village situated in the Benipatti subdivision of Madhubani district, Bihar. It is located approximately 14 km from the tehsil headquarters in Benipatti and around 44 km from the district headquarters in Madhubani. Shahpur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Bandolwa village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Bandolwa is 220286. The village covers a total geographical area of 7.41 hectares and falls under the 847102 pincode. Madhubani is the nearest town, located about 40 km away.
Bandolwa village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Benipatti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Madhubani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Bandolwa
As per Census 2011, Bandolwa village has a total population of 206 people, consisting of 108 males and 98 females. The village has 30 households and a sex ratio of 907 females per 1,000 males. There are 53 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 49 literate and 157 illiterate residents.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Bandolwa are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 206 | 108 | 98 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 53 | 30 | 23 |
| Literate Population | 49 | 27 | 22 |
| Illiterate Population | 157 | 81 | 76 |

Transport and Connectivity of Bandolwa
Public transport facilities are available within 5-10 km of the Bandolwa. The nearest railway station is located within 5-10 km of Bandolwa.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Railway Station | No | Available within 5-10 km |

Banking and Postal Services in Bandolwa
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Bandolwa village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within 2-5 km |
Health Facilities in Bandolwa
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Bandolwa village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
